GRAHAM v. PREFERRED RISK MUTUAL INS. CO.

No. 10645.

18 Utah 2d 429 (1967)

424 P.2d 880

DOROTHY GRAHAM AND JOE LOPEZ, PLAINTIFFS AND APPELLANT, v. PREFERRED RISK MUTUAL INSURANCE COMPANY OF DES MOINES, IOWA, A MUTUAL INSURANCE COMPANY, DEFENDANT AND RESPONDENT.

Supreme Court of Utah.

March 3, 1967.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Mark S. Miner, Salt Lake City, for appellant.

Kipp & Charlier, Carman E. Kipp, D. Gary Christian, Salt Lake City, for respondent.


HARDING, District Judge:

On June 3, 1960, the plaintiff, Dorothy Graham, applied to the defendant, Preferred Risk Mutual Insurance Company of Des Moines, Iowa, for an automobile insurance policy for collision and comprehensive coverage. The application contained in bold type immediately above the line for her signature the words, "I do not use alcoholic beverages and will not do so for the term of the policy."
